Comprehending Key Types for the Volvo V40

Before delving into the costs, it's important to comprehend the types of keys used in the Volvo V40. Depending upon the model year and specs, Volvo V40 keys usually fall under one of the following classifications:

Key Type

Description

Approximate Price Range

Standard Key

Standard metal key without electronic parts

₤ 10 - ₤ 50

Remote Key

Key with incorporated push-button control for locking/unlocking

₤ 150 - ₤ 300

Smart Key

Advanced key fob with push-button start features

₤ 250 - ₤ 500

Elements Influencing Replacement Costs

A number of elements can affect the cost of a replacement key for the Volvo V40. Comprehending these variables will help chauffeurs make informed decisions when the time comes for replacement.

  1. Type of Key: As detailed in the table above, costs differ significantly depending upon whether you require a standard key, a remote key, or a smart key.
  2. Programming Fees: Modern keys frequently need programming to interact with the lorry's onboard computer. This can increase the overall cost significantly.
  3. Dealer vs. Locksmith: Replacement keys can be gotten either through a Volvo dealer or through an independent locksmith. Car dealerships tend to charge more however might supply additional security and warranty alternatives.
  4. Model Year: The age of the Volvo V40 matters. Older models might have less complicated keys needing less programming, while more recent designs typically involve more advanced innovation.
  5. Location: Depending on where you live, labor expenses and the availability of parts can differ, resulting in various rates in different areas.

Cost Breakdown: Dealership vs. Locksmith

Here's a basic breakdown of the prospective costs connected with getting a replacement Volvo V40 key through a dealer versus a locksmith.

Company

Type of Key

Estimated Cost

Programming Fee

Overall Estimated Cost

Volvo Dealership

Conventional Key

₤ 10 - ₤ 50

₤ 50

₤ 60 - ₤ 100

Volvo Dealership

Remote Key

₤ 150 - ₤ 300

₤ 100

₤ 250 - ₤ 400

Volvo Dealership

Smart Key

₤ 250 - ₤ 500

₤ 150

₤ 400 - ₤ 650

Independent Locksmith

Standard Key

₤ 10 - ₤ 30

₤ 10

₤ 20 - ₤ 40

Independent Locksmith

Remote Key

₤ 100 - ₤ 200

₤ 50

₤ 150 - ₤ 250

Independent Locksmith

Smart Key

₤ 200 - ₤ 400

₤ 100

₤ 300 - ₤ 500

Regularly Asked Questions

1. Can I change a Volvo V40 key myself?

While some fundamental keys can be cut and used immediately, most contemporary keys need programming to operate correctly with the vehicle. It is usually advised to have an expert deal with the replacement.

2. What do I need to give the dealer for a key replacement?

You will need to bring legitimate recognition, proof of ownership (like the automobile registration), and any existing keys you may have, if possible.

3. The length of time does it take to get a replacement key?

The time taken can differ. A locksmith may be able to supply a new key within an hour or 2, while a dealership may take longer, often requiring to buy specific parts, particularly for smart keys.

4. Is it worth getting a spare key?

Yes, having a spare key can save time and money in the future. It is a good safety web in case of emergencies or lost keys.

5. Are there distinctions in cost by key fob design?

Yes, the style and technology incorporated into the key fob can substantially affect the cost. More advanced fobs with functions like remote start or keyless entry typically cost more.
